Information about #EB970E color
Basic facts about this digital color
#EB970E presents itself as a intensely saturated warm orange — one that carries an easy, daylight feel. In practice it works well for accents, call-to-action elements and statement visuals.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a hair away from Gamboge (#E49B0F). Slightly further away sit Rich Orange (#F38D11) and Kumquat (#FB9912).
Technically, the mix leans on its red channel (rgb(235, 151, 14)), which gives #EB970E its character. Accessibility-wise, black text works best on #EB970E: 9.0:1 contrast (passing WCAG AAA) versus 2.3:1 for white. No one has named #EB970E so far. #EB970E color harmonies
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.
Complementary
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.
Split complementary
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.
Analogous
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.
Triadic
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.
Tetradic
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.
Square
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
